Male and female pelves differ in all of the following features except __________.
A. the male pelvis is more massive
B. the male pelvic outlet is smaller
C. the female pubic arch is usually greater than 100 degrees
D. the female coccyx is tilted posteriorly
E. the female sacrum is longer
E. the female sacrum is longer
